ROMAN EMPIRE: Theodosius I, 379-395 AD, AV solidus (4.53g), Constantinople, struck 383-388 AD, RIC-71B, 10th officina, rosette-diademed, draped, and cuirassed bust right, D N THEODO-SIVS P F AVG // Constantinopolis seated facing, head right, right foot on prow, holding scepter and shield inscribed VOT / X / MVLT / XV, CONCORDI-A AVGGG I / CONOB, light hairlines, EF to About Unc.
